WebDo Not Tie Pacifier Around Child’s Neck as it Presents a Strangulation Danger. Care: Prior to first use, sanitize by boiling in water for 5 minutes. For daily cleaning, wash with hot water and mild detergent then rinse clean. Dishwasher-safe (top rack). Water may get inside the nipple during cleaning, and can be removed by squeezing the nipple.
